摘要
针对储油罐机械清洗作业中使用的移动式蒸汽锅炉尾气除尘降温效果不佳,能源浪费严重的问题,制定了应对措施,并开展了大量现场试验。通过有效扩大换热面积、改变换热方式的方法,在箱体外侧添加利用重力除尘原理的水幕除尘装置,简化氮热一体化冷却装置箱体结构,自制清扫除尘装置,达到了锅炉尾气降温、除尘的预期目的,热能利用率提升了20%以上。
In view of the poor efficiency and serious energy waste of the movable steam boiler used in the mechanical cleaning of the oil storage tank, the countermeasures were formulated and a lot of field experiments were carried out. Through the effective expansion of the heat exchange area and the change of heat transfer process, the water curtain dust removal device using gravity dedusting principle was added in the outer side of the box body, the structure of the nitrogen heat integration cooling device was simplified, and the self- made cleaning and dust removing device was added to achieve the purpose of the boiler exhaust gas cooling and dust removal. Therefore, the heat utilization increased by more than 20%.
